1986 Cadillac Allante vs. 2005 Volvo S80

To start off, 2005 Volvo S80 is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 Cadillac Allante.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 Cadillac Allante would be higher. At 4,087 cc (8 cylinders), 1986 Cadillac Allante is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Volvo S80 (197 HP @ 1800 RPM) has 28 more horse power than 1986 Cadillac Allante. (169 HP @ 4300 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Volvo S80 should accelerate faster than 1986 Cadillac Allante.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1986 Cadillac Allante weights approximately 14 kg more than 2005 Volvo S80.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1986 Cadillac Allante (324 Nm @ 3200 RPM) has 44 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Volvo S80. (280 Nm @ 1800 RPM). This means 1986 Cadillac Allante will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Volvo S80.
